What are the signs that your septic tank is full?

Signs of a full septic tank include slow drains, sewage odors around the drain field, and gurgling sounds from your plumbing. In Colorado, extreme weather can exacerbate these issues. Prompt attention prevents costly damage to your property and the environment.

Can I install my own septic system in Colorado?

While some homeowners may consider DIY installation, Colorado has strict permitting and licensing requirements for septic systems. Improper installation can lead to environmental contamination and legal issues. Professional installation ensures compliance and long-term system integrity.

When should I schedule septic tank maintenance in Centennial?

Regular septic tank maintenance in Centennial should occur every 1-3 years, depending on household size and water usage. However, Colorado's variable weather patterns may necessitate more frequent checks. Proactive care prevents emergencies.
